Meet Mr. Whimsey - Me! | | Joe Gerson | As a designer, scenic painter and greeting card originator, I have enjoyed a happy career as an artist. And with my art work I want to spread a little joy!As a graduate of Pennsylvania State University, I majored in art and participated in college drama groups, where I tried to utilize and sharpen my artistic and technical capabilities. It was during this time that I became interested in stage design. After graduating from Penn State in 1950, I embarked on a career of set designing for many summer theatres throughout the northeast. I designed scenery for both Proscenium and 'In the Round' theatres. Soon after, I moved to New York City where I furthered my studies at Columbia University and The Lester Polakov Studio and Forum of Stage Design. I took and passed an art examination for the United Scenic Artists Union. Then I became involved in scenic painting for the theatre, ABC and NBC television networks, many TV commercial sets and some movies. I also spent three years painting scenery at the Metropolitan Opera Company in New York City. 
While painting commercially to support myself, I began to create my own paintings and have shown much of my work at several major art galleries and shopping malls throughout New York, New Jersey and Pennsylvania. To my great delight I won a first prize for a painting of my 'Conductor' whimsey at the Washington Square Outdoor Exhibit in New York City.
